change the speed, you just need to right-click a clip and you can
change those speed. Right-click, select
speed and duration. Who wanted to change the speed. You can see the
screen or you can also change the duration
of the playback. Say if a video clip is of ten minutes length and you change the duration from ten
minutes to five minutes. It will increase the
playback speed by two. It will be ice
pre-play back. Here. We can also create a replica

some sequence settings. What our sequence settings, sequence settings allow you to control how your video would be exported,
various properties. It could be visual
properties like frame size and audio sample
rate and other things. So just go to sequence menu, select the sequence settings, the first option in the bar, and this pop-up window will
allow you various settings. So you can select the
editing mode from custom. Just select the custom. If you don't know what to
select and if you want to decide any particular
editing mode for a DSLR, Canon camera or any
adulting you can select. Then you can select
a frame size, horizontal and vertical
dimensions for the frame. If you want to have a
higher-quality like 1920 by 1080 pixels, you can select, this would
be 16 to nine aspect ratio. You can have 750 cross 360 size, frame size as well. Depending on the quality. Also you can export in Forky. But remember if you are
exploiting a video in for k, all the clips must
also be in forking. Otherwise it will
be meaningless. I will just increase the size of your video without actually
increasing the quality. It's better to. I have a higher-quality
clippings and then select the higher-quality
for export settings. You can also select
anything you want. You can select the
audio sample rate. If you want a rich audio, you can select 96
thousand hertz. If you want to have
an average audio, you can select 48
thousand hertz. Or if you want to
have a below average, you can have a 32,013 depending on the sample
rate. Youtube's. Then you can select the time-based number
of frames per second. You can select 30 frame first against 60
frames per second, 15, anything you want. And after you're done with this, just go to the file,

properties using effects control and keyframe. So fs control is a window
panel in Premier Pro that allows you to control various properties set on
a video clip, AudioClip. Anything else On that is
available on the timeline? Just go to Effect Control. And here you can see some default properties
such as opacity, Transform, Scale, Rotation,
time remapping and much more. Here we are just going
to set some keyframes. Keyframes are already used in various animating softwares, such as After Effects and mode. Here you can see the
default opacity is set to a 100% and you can change it to any percentage
that you want, ranging from 0 to 100%. Using this property,
we can create a kind of animation
that is gradual. What we are going to do is
to select the first clip and click on the little diamond
icon next to the opacity. And provided value of opacity. Say, if we select the 0% or 50% and select the
key frame here, it will start with
the 50% opacity. Later on on the next key frame. We can change it to a 100%. So you can see that in the
beginning it was 50% opec. And later on it
gets a little boat, little bit more bright and the opacity is controlled
using this key frames. You can have similar kinds of effects in all your video clips. If you are editing some videos and want to show some light, you have multiple clips. You can also create your
transition on your own. You might know how to add video transitions
such as dissolved and is always nothing other than the change of opacity values. You can create these things. If you are a beginner, you would just simply use all the ready-made transitions without understanding

same in all the properties. You can also go into the detailed properties
such as anchor point. People who don't know
what is anchor point. Anchor point is the center of the video where
everything is pivoted. Right now, we have set the anchor point
to the default value. And default it is centered around the center of the screen. So our video looks like it
emerges out of the center. If you set it to the corner, it emerged from the corner. You can also change
